The present invention relates to wireless communications systems. More specifically, it relates to generating feedback for multiple-input multiple-output (MIMO) systems.
Multiple-input multiple-output (MIMO) is a family of techniques that utilize multiple antennas at the transmitter and/or at the receiver to exploit the spatial dimension in order to improve data throughput and transmission reliability. The data throughput can be increased by either spatial multiplexing or beamforming. Spatial multiplexing allows multiple data streams to be transmitted simultaneously to the same user through parallel channels in the MIMO setting. This is especially true for diversity antennas where spatial correlation is low between antennas (both at the transmitter and the receiver). Beamforming helps to enhance the signal-to-interference-plus-noise ratio (SINR) of the channel, thus improving the channel rate.
Such SINR improvement is achieved by proper weighting over multiple transmit antennas and the weight calculation can be based on either long-term measurement (e.g., open-loop) or via feedback (e.g., closed-loop). Closed-loop transmit weighting is often called precoding in the context of MIMO study.
References to background prior art include the following publications:
A MIMO broadcast channel can be described as follows, where there is K receiver and the transmitter has M>1 antennas:
y
i
=h
i
·x+n
i
,i=1,2, . . . K (0.1),
with E[∥x∥2]<P.
When linear precoding is used, the transmitter multiplies the signal intended for each user with a beamforming vector, and transmits the sum of these vector signals:
where v denotes the beamforming vector.
Beamforming vectors can be based on the zero-forcing principle, in which the beamforming vector for user equipment (UE) is chosen to be orthogonal to the channel vector of all other users.
Linear precoding performance depends on the choice of beamforming vectors, which is decided from the channel feedback from each UE. To achieve the capacity of a multi-user MIMO channel, the accurate channel state information is necessary at the transmitter. However, in real systems, receivers feedback the partial channel state information to the transmitter in order to efficiently use the uplink feedback channel resource, which is the multi-user MIMO system with limited feedback precoding.
When there is an imperfection of this channel knowledge, some degree of multiuser interference is inevitably introduced, leading to performance degradation. An example of such imperfection is quantization. Quantization error is related to the bits used. It can be seen that quantization error ζ can be bounded as follows:
where M is the total number of transmit antennas and B is the total bits used to quantize the feedback. To further analyze and quantify the performance degradation caused by imperfect feedback, system rate loss can be defined as follows:
It can be shown that:
According to Equation 0.5, rate loss is an increasing function of the system P: signal-to-noise ration (SNR). In other words, in order to maintain a bounded rate loss, the number of feedback bits per mobile needs to be scaled. This can be expressed in another format: If we fix the feedback bits per UE, then the rate that each UE can be achieved by quantized feedback is bounded by
as SNR is approaching infinity.
The present invention provides spatial CSI feedback for MIMO operation of unexpectedly improved accuracy while keeping the feedback overhead as low as possible.
In accordance with an aspect, the invention is a method and system for generating feedback in a MIMO system that includes performing measurements of channel conditions; selecting subsets of codebooks based on the measurements; selecting codewords from the codebooks based on certain criteria; assigning indices to the codewords; and feeding back the indices.
In another aspect, the invention is a UE configured to make a channel condition measurement and report the channel condition measurement to a base station. The UE can be further configured to measure an instantaneous radio channel and choose codewords from a subset of a codebook corresponding to the feedback rate region classification. In some embodiments, the UE is also configured to decide a feedback rate region classification for the UE based on the channel condition measurement and a predefined threshold. In some aspects, the UE is configured to choose codewords, from a subset of a codebook corresponding to the feedback rate region classification, based on a minimal distance of a codeword and a channel vector or a maximal capacity criterion. Finally, the UE can be configured to feed back the codewords to a base station.
In another aspect, the invention is a base station configured to decide a feedback rate region classification for a UE based on a channel condition measurement and convey the feedback rate region classification to the UE through downlink signaling. The base station can be further configured to calculate precoding matrices.
As noted, fixed feedback rate systems achieve only a bounded throughput. To realize full multiplexing gain, the feedback rate is adaptively increased to the system SNR. Accordingly, the feedback method of the present invention divides a cell into a plurality of feedback rate regions and each region employs a subset of a codebook having a different characterization based on average radio channel conditions. Different characterization includes granularity and spatial signature. For example, according to the invention the cell is divided into a cell center (high feedback rate) region and a cell edge (low feedback rate) region. In the low feedback rate region, for example, a Release 8 based 4-bit codebook is used, while in the high feedback rate region, a 6-bit codebook is employed.
According to an embodiment of the present invention, there is provided a method for multiple-input multiple-output (MIMO) to generate feedback, which includes:
According to a preferred embodiment, the method of the present invention further includes dividing the cell area into a plurality of feedback rate regions according to long term radio channel conditions. More preferably, radio channel conditions are determined by mobile radio channel measurement reporting.
In another embodiment, indication of the feedback rate region is determined by predefined radio channel thresholds known at the mobile station or by transmission of certain messages from a base station.
In a further embodiment, a plurality of codewords is partitioned into multiple sub codebooks, each of which corresponds to one of the feedback regions. Preferably, each sub codebook has different feedback granularity.
In yet another embodiment, indices of codewords are selected so that the distance between the quantized composite spatial CSI and the floating-point composite spatial CSI is minimized.
The invention is described in detail by reference to the three figures of the drawings.
At the UE, the radio channel condition is measured first. The measurement is reported to the base station and used when deciding which feedback rate region the UE will be classified. This feedback rate region information is conveyed to the UE by the base station through a downlink signaling form known in the art. Alternatively, the UE can decide the feedback region itself based on the radio channel measurement and a certain predefined threshold known both to the eNB and UE.
As shown in
In a simulation study, signal-to-leakage-and-noise ratio (SLNR) criteria are used to determine the precoders in multi-user MIMO (MU-MIMO). These criteria are referenced in M. Sadek, A. Tarighat, and A. H. Sayed, “A leakage-based precoding scheme for downlink multi-user MIMO channels,” IEEE Trans. Wireless Commun., vol. 6, no. 5, pp. 1711-1721, May 2007, and also in 3GPP, R1-092635, “Feedback comparison in supporting LTE-A MU-MIMO and CoMP operations”, Motorola, RAN1#57bis, Los Angeles, USA, June 2009.
In the case of two-user MIMO, the precoders for User 1 and User 2 can be calculated as
In a beamforming antenna configuration with rank=1 per user, only one vector (normally corresponding to the strongest eigen-mode) is used as the column vectors to construct precoding vectors.
The simulation is carried out in semi-analytical fashion. Particularly for MU-MIMO, the steps are as follows.
The procedure from Step 2 to Step 5 is looped multiple times, each with an independent spatial channel realization. The calculated capacities are of an ergodic nature. Spatial channel model (SCM) Suburban Macro (SMa) scenario is assumed. See 3GPP, TR 25.996 v7.0.0 (2007-06), “Spatial channel model for multiple input multiple output (MIMO) simulations.” For each channel realization, the spatial CSI feedback is at subcarrier level. In MU-MIMO, the two users are forced to do MU-MIMO, even occasionally the channel realizations lead to poor separation of eigenmodes between users and thus may degrade the sum rate. In other words, MU-MIMO mode never falls back to single-user MIMO (SU-MIMO) mode.
A uniform linear array (ULA) of four vertical-polarization antennas are assumed at the transmitter. The antenna spacing is 0.5λ. The receiver is equipped with two antennas. In the case of element-wise quantization of matrix “Ri,” as described in 3GPP, R1-092635, “Feedback comparison in supporting LTE-A MU-MIMO and CoMP operations,” Motorola, RAN1#57bis, Los Angeles, USA, June 2009, 3 bits and 5 bits are used for the amplitude and the phase of each element. A smaller number of bits is allocated for the amplitude than for the phase information because the entire matrix is first normalized by the amplitude of the largest element, a procedure that reduces the dynamic range of the elements in different channel realizations. Ignoring the number of bits for this normalization, the element-wise quantization requires 3×4+(3+5)×6=60 bits. Quantization levels for amplitude and phase are listed in Table 1, below. The levels are not necessarily optimized. Rather, the quantization levels are intuitively selected to capture the general statistics anticipated for the matrix elements.
SU-MIMO is also simulated to see the gains of MU-MIMO and the sensitivity to feedback accuracies. Rank adaptation is enabled between rank=2 and rank=1. In the precoding matrix index (PMI) approach, the 4-bit Rel. 8 LTE codebook is used that has entries for both beamforming and diversity scenarios.
The ergodic-constrained capacities of SU-MIMO and MU-MIMO are compared in
Many modifications, alterations, and embodiments may be apparent to those skilled in the art based on the foregoing description. For example, based on the results shown, codebooks with finer granularities than Rel 8 are considered for use in accordance within the scope of the present invention.
Number | Date | Country | |
---|---|---|---|
61294197 | Jan 2010 | US |
Number | Date | Country | |
---|---|---|---|
Parent | 13521960 | Oct 2012 | US |
Child | 14667738 | US |